Attention: owners of '03-04 Accords
I found this info. on page 117 of the Sept/04 edition of "Popular Mechanics". "Idle vibration in the steering wheel and front seat of your 2003-04 4 cylinder Honda Accord getting on your nerves? Technical Service Bulletin 04-024 has two repair procedures. One involves replacing an engine mount and tightening the engine mount bolts. The second adds extra radiator mounts and weights to the front bumper's resonsant frequency out of idle range."
